The Microfiber Advantage: Dust Capture Dynamics


The kit prominently features microfiber duster heads. These are visible in various shapes and sizes, all exhibiting the characteristic fluffy, high-pile texture of microfiber material. The images show several distinct head types, including a large, rounded duster, a smaller, more compact duster, and a flat, thin duster.

Microfiber is renowned for its electrostatic properties, which allow it to attract and hold dust particles, pet hair, and allergens with exceptional efficiency. This material acts like a magnet for airborne debris, preventing it from being redistributed into the air during cleaning. It captures, rather than scatters.

Traditional feather dusters or cotton cloths often merely push dust around, leading to dust settling elsewhere shortly after cleaning. The microfiber technology in this kit provides a superior dust-trapping capability, resulting in a cleaner environment that stays dust-free for longer. This is a fundamental improvement in cleaning efficacy.
